The Specialty Equipment Market Association (SEMA) has contracted with master builder and television personality Bryan Fuller and long-time educator and author Mark Prosser to team up to teach several seminars on welding and fabricating at their booth during SEMA’s signature event Nov. 1–4 at the Las Vegas Convention Center.

Three options:

TIG vs. MIG – Which One is Right for You? The choice of welding process is as much a question of preference as it is a question of your goals. What materials are you welding? What are the applications of the finished product? This seminar will put new welders on the road to deciding which process is best for their individual applications, so they can choose the equipment that best meets their needs.

Take the Mystery Out of Welding 4130. 4130 Chrome-moly is an alloy that is popular among auto and racing enthusiasts for its light weight and strength, relative to conventional steel. Applications for this material range from suspension components to roll cages. Yet there are some common misconceptions about welding 4130 tubing. This seminar will seek to demystify the process, explain what 4130 is, as well as how to prep, tack and weld it for maximum benefit.

Purging vs. Not Purging Stainless: What You Don’t See May Be Hurting You. Stainless steel tubing is a staple material among performance exhaust fabricators. But in order to make a weld that looks (and performs) as good on the outside as it does on the inside, purging is an important but often overlooked step. This seminar will demonstrate correct techniques for purging, show how purging benefits the quality and appearance of the weld, and how it can also enhance the performance of your exhaust system.
